Sonya Eddy on "Desperate Housewives"

If you missed last night's season finale of

Desperate Housewives

you also missed a cameo by

General Hospital's

Sonya Eddy as Vanessa. Ironically, or maybe not so much, the character of Vanessa really isn't much different than the role of Epiphany but it seems that Sonya has found her niche and knows how to nail it every time. Congrats to Sonya on the cameo!